Click on the "Mail" tab at CJ and you should be able to send an internal CJ email to the merchant. There's no guarantee that they check their internal CJ email (most affiliates and many merchants don't), but it's worth a shot. You'll want to check your "Inbox" at CJ periodically for a reply from the merchant.

I'm assuming that you're in a country that the merchant doesn't service, but that your site is targeted to the area that your merchant services. Let the merchant know that. They might be willing to make an exception.

contact the merchant directly through a 800 number on the merchant web site and ask for an affiliate program manager( or internet marketing manager). if the merchant is a decent size company, there should be a dedicated person for the affiliate program. It is always nice to talk to a PERSON than an automated system.

When I applied to a few merchants on CJ, one of the merchants sent a reject email within 0.5 second. ;-)

I think they only accept applications if the affiliates belong to the preselected categories.

since i had a few sites listed on the account for different categories, the merchant rejected my application without looking at my main site. Most of others approved my site after visiting my site.
